What are soft skills?

Soft skills are per­son­al and inter­per­son­al qual­i­ties that play an impor­tant role in a com­pa­ny. Thanks to soft skills, employ­ees can bet­ter under­stand the pro­fes­sion­al envi­ron­ment around them.

Soft skills to have in a company

To give you an idea of the dif­fer­ent soft skills that are present in com­pa­nies, Jérôme Hoa­rau and Julien Bouret, authors of the book Le réflexe soft skills, les com­pé­tences des lead­ers de demain (The soft skills reflex, the skills of tomor­row’s lead­ers), have iden­ti­fied 15 soft skills to be mas­tered by 2020.Problem solving

  1. Con­fi­dence
  2. Emo­tion­al intelligence.
  3. Empa­thy
  4. Com­mu­ni­ca­tion skills
  5. Time man­age­ment
  6. Stress man­age­ment
  7. Cre­ativ­i­ty
  8. Entre­pre­neur­ial spirit
  9. Bold­ness
  10. Moti­va­tion
  11. Vision, visu­al­iza­tion
  12. Pres­ence
  13. Sense of teamwork
  14. Curios­i­ty

How to train your employees in soft skills?

If most of these skills are inter­per­son­al and intu­itive, it is pos­si­ble to devel­op them. There are three ways to help your employ­ees devel­op these new skills.

  • The train­ing

Train­ing cours­es allow you to devel­op cer­tain soft skills such as cre­ativ­i­ty and time man­age­ment.   • Coach­ing

Cor­po­rate coach­ing also works very well for the devel­op­ment of soft skills. After an analy­sis of the needs of your employ­ees con­cern­ing soft skills, coach­ing ses­sions will allow you to work on key com­pe­ten­cies in a col­lec­tive or indi­vid­ual way.

  • Prac­ti­cal workshops

Putting into prac­tice the notions seen dur­ing the e‑learning cours­es or the coach­ing ses­sions is the stage that per­fect­ly con­cludes the devel­op­ment of soft skills in a com­pa­ny. Dur­ing these work­shops, you can bring your teams togeth­er to par­tic­i­pate in role-play­ing games which con­cern, for exam­ple, empa­thy, com­mu­ni­ca­tion, team spir­it, etc. You can also set up a real project that will require the use of all these skills such as the cre­ation of a micro-busi­ness (fic­ti­tious or real) with­in the com­pa­ny in order to mobi­lize all the soft skills men­tioned above.
